What is a 2-Inch Submersible Pump?
A 2-inch submersible pump is designed to operate while submerged in the fluid it is pumping. Typically, these pumps are less than 2 inches in diameter, allowing them to fit into confined spaces like wells, cisterns, and tanks. They are engineered to push water to the surface by converting mechanical energy into hydraulic energy, making them highly efficient for moving fluids.

Common Applications
2-inch submersible pumps are widely used in various sectors
- Residential Homeowners often use them for dewatering basements, emptying swimming pools, or supplying water for irrigation systems.
- Agriculture Farmers utilize these pumps for irrigation purposes, helping to ensure crops receive sufficient water, particularly in dry seasons.
- Industrial In industrial settings, they are used for sampling groundwater or managing wastewater, showcasing their adaptability in different environments.
